LESS vs FEWER.
If a quantity can be counted, it is FEWER.
If a quantity is an abstract amount, it is LESS.
example:
Three people left the crowd. Now there are three fewer people. It is NOT "three less people"
I drank some of my water and now there is less water in my glass. the preceding sentance correctly uses "less"

It's and its drives me nuts.
Possessive is its, "it is" is it's.
